11 Dec

Are you having problems picking which computer science path to take? Fortunately, there are many different computer science career paths to choose from, and we'll help you figure out which one is right for you in this article.

Start by figuring out what aspects of computers make you happy; be the Marie Kondo of computer science. Which profession do you think you'd be best suited for? Because many students choose computer science with only a foggy idea of what they want to do, it requires some investigation. In the future, many young engineers see themselves as hackers. Soon, you'll realize that the possibilities are endless, and the range of computer science careers may increase in ways you never imagined.

What Is Computer Science?

Computer science is the study of computers and computing systems. Computer scientists, unlike electrical and computer engineers, focus on software and software systems, encompassing theory, design, development, and implementation.

Computer science includes significant topics such as artificial intelligence, computer systems, and networks, security, database systems, human-computer interaction, vision, and graphics, numerical analysis, programming languages, software engineering, bioinformatics, and computing theory.

Programming is an important part of computer science, although it is only one facet of the discipline. Computer scientists develop and study algorithms to solve issues and investigate the performance of computer hardware and software. Computer scientists deal with a wide range of issues, from the abstract (determining what problems can be solved with computers and the complexity of the algorithms that solve them) to the concrete (determining what problems can be solved with computers and the complexity of the algorithms that solve them) (designing applications that work well on handheld devices, are simple to use, and adhere to security measures).

Computer science graduates from the University of Maryland are lifelong learners who can quickly adapt to new situations.

Types Of Computer Science Career Paths

  • Software engineer
  • Web developer 
  • Hardware engineer
  • Computer programmer
  • Database administrator
  • Systems analysts 
  • Network architect
  • Health Information Tech Specialists
  • Video Game Developer

Software Engineer

Within the subject of software engineering, a software engineer might design either applications or systems. Software engineers help companies figure out the optimal strategy for achieving their software development goals. Multiple phases are required because software engineers can perform a wide range of tasks. They can work in a variety of environments, such as IT firms and corporate offices. This is the initial professional route in computer science.

Web Developer

For creative students, web development is a popular option. It entails creating a clean and polished appearance by designing and coding code to establish the style and formatting. Front-end coding languages such as HTML, CSS, and JavaScript are often used by web developers. By focusing on functionality and pleasing aesthetics, web developers bridge the gap between a client's brand and specifications and the user experience. People with a bachelor's degree, an associate's degree, or even a coding Bootcamp certification are frequently hired for web development employment. This is the second career route in computer science.

Hardware Engineer

To become a hardware engineer, you'll need more hands-on computer experience, both physically and mechanically. Among other internal computer components, a hardware engineer works on the CPU, memory, and motherboard. They can also work on automobiles and medical equipment. Hardware engineering includes a lot of hands-on implementation. They work with a group of software developers, engineers, and clients to bring the concept to reality. This is the third professional route in computer science.

Computer Programmer

Computer programming necessitates the use of programming languages and libraries (collections of code made to ease and speed up the creation of new code). A computer programmer writes code based on a software developer's or engineer's design to construct software applications. In other words, computer programmers bring software concepts to life. Testing and enhancing existing software code is also part of computer programming. This is the fourth professional route in computer science.

Conclusion

In this blog, you have learned the best computer science career paths in detail. I hope you have understood the best computer science career paths. And also if you need computer science assignment help, then contact our professional expert.

Comments
* The email will not be published on the website.
I BUILT MY SITE FOR FREE USING